Ingredients
- 2 tbsp. olive oil
- 4 shallots, thinly sliced
- 1 bay leaf
- 1 garlic clove, minced
- 1/4 cup white wine
- 4 6- to 8-oz. skinless stone or black bass fillets
- 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
- 4 cups fish stock
- 1 lb. littleneck clams, cleaned
- 1/2 cup heavy cream
- 1 tbsp. flat-leaf parsley leaves
- Boiled new potatoes, for serving
